Berg Berg Photography is an adventurous, authentic and inclusive wedding photography business in Golden, Colorado.

An ADVENTURE-loving husband/wife team with 20 years of professional experience capturing artistic photographic memories for couples and families. Most of our work is near Golden but we will travel anywhere in the Southwestern United States, especially mountain biking destinations.

AUTHENTIC means your photos will be timeless, you will look like you without the latest filter fad so you won’t look back on your photos and cringe. We are both artists, not just people with fancy cameras. We use an unobtrusive, journalistic style of photography to tell your story.

We are looking for the elements of your style, emotional moments and details of your wedding or event that make it uniquely yours. We are especially interested in capturing the energy and connection you have and will accomplish that with coaching when you’re unsure what to do. We have photographed in all types of Colorado weather and are prepared for anything. We do not outsource, we edit all of our own images. We carry insurance required for many Colorado venues.

INCLUSIVE is not just a token buzzword to us. We have had LGBTQ family and chosen family way before it was as accepted to be out and legally married. Love is love, we see you and support you. We have photographed Hindu, Mulsim, Jewish, Christian, Buddhist, Pagan, Humanistic and Star Wars ceremonies. We are there to document your day however you choose to celebrate.

Kevin Bergthold
Lead Photographer

Kevin Bergthold photographer at Berg Berg Photography

Kevin has been an award winning professional photographer since 2004. He is a member of the international Wedding Photojournalist Association currently ranked as one of the Top Wedding Photographers in Colorado. He is a member of Fearless Photographers, a competitive group of international wedding photographers at the top of their game. His work has also been featured in Rock n Roll Bride.

Kevin grew up in the thick of skateboarding and punk rock near Sacramento, California and approaches his work with an alternative eye, not always following the rules learned at Brooks Institute studying for his Bachelor of Arts Degree in Professional Photography. He has photographed  250+ weddings. Kevin has also photographed hundreds of portraits. Living in Colorado since 2006, he’s had the opportunity to work and explore all over the state. Kevin is a Photoshop expert, we don’t outsource anything, every photo is hand edited with his expertise. Latest obsession: Adding 35mm film photography to a shoot.

Michelle Blomberg
Photographer & Marketing

Michelle Blomberg photographer at Berg Berg Photography

Michelle has a Bachelor of Fine Arts Degree in Visual Communications and a Master’s of Education degree. She worked in web design and marketing in Ann Arbor and Detroit, Michigan where she started teaching digital arts at the college level in 1998 at the College for Creative Studies. She is currently tenured faculty at Glendale Community College near Phoenix where they also have a home.

Michelle is also a member of Fearless Photographers. Her photographic style is influenced by her background in design and ability to connect with her subjects. Upon meeting Kevin in 2015, they have collaborated professionally and in 2021 rebranded his photography business as Berg Berg to reflect their partnership as photographers.

Why Berg Berg?

As a husband/wife team, we don’t have the same last name but the names both have a “berg” or “mountain” in Swedish. We enjoy our mountains every chance we get, on and off shoot.
